of Oakfield Road, Altrincham
of Southport
Company formed by W. H. Barrett and C. C. Cardell
1902 Acquired Phoenix Works in Southport from Felix William Hudlass
1904-06 Made automobiles
1910 Advertising the Barcar range of petrol and paraffin engines rated 3 to 24 hp and primarily for the marine market [1]
